My Mom's tuna casserole; the one with cashews & chow mein noodles -- don't talk to me about <i>peas</i> in tuna casserole! McVities Dark Chocolate Home Wheats bought at a tobacconist in Knightsbridge in the early dusk of a London winter. Rice, black beans, fried plantains and a Carta Blanca beer from a roadside restaurant in the Yucatan with a fully loaded truck in front, surrounded by pieces of its engine as it’s being repaired, a sink for washing your hands in the corner inside, and screen for walls from the waist up. Gerte gu tooy bought from a woman on the street in Senegal: peanuts harvested before they mature, when they’re still sweet, crunchy, and delicious, then roasted in hot sand over a charcoal fire -- one of the best foods I’ve ever eaten. And of course, Idaho russet potatoes with butter and salt.
